Anotation

IEC 62271-203:2022 CMV contains both the official standard and its commented version. The commented version provides you with a quick and easy way to compare all the changes between IEC 62271-203:2022 edition 3.0 and the previous IEC 62271-203:2011 edition 2.0. Furthermore, comments from IEC SC 17C experts are provided to explain the reasons of the most relevant changes, or to clarify any part of the content. IEC 62271-203:2022 specifies requirements for gas-insulated metal-enclosed switchgear in which the insulation is obtained, at least partly, by an insulating gas or gas mixture other than air at atmospheric pressure, for alternating current of rated voltages above 52 kV, for indoor and outdoor installation, and for service frequencies up to and including 60 Hz. This third edition cancels and replaces the second edition published in 2011. This edition constitutes a technical revision. This edition includes the following significant technical changes with respect to the previous edition: - the document has been aligned with IEC 62271-1:2017; - beside SF6 also alternative gases have been implemented where needed; - the terms and definitions have been updated and terms not used have been removed; - Subclause 6.16 “Gas and vacuum tightness” has been updated; - Subclause 6.16.3 “Closed pressure systems”: Two classes of gas has been introduced: - GWP <= 1 000 - GWP > 1 000 and the tightness requirements for type tests for gasses with GWP > 1 000 has been reduced from 0,5 % to 0,1 % per year per gas compartment; - Subclause 6.108 “Interfaces”: Typical maximum pressures in service for interfaces connected to GIS have been defined; - Subclauses 7.102 through 7.108 have been restructured; - Subclause 7.107 “Corrosion test on earthing connections” has been updated; - Subclause 7.108 “Corrosion tests on sealing systems of enclosures and auxiliary equipment” has been updated; - Annex F ‘Service Continuity’ has been modified and aligned with the recommendations of CIGRE WG B3.51.
